Coconut Pecan Lime Bars

Ingredients:
- 2 cups flour 
- 4 tablespoons sugar 
- 1/8 teaspoon salt 
- 1 stick, plus 2 1/2 tablespoons butter 
- 4 eggs, beaten 
- 1 cup pecans, chopped 
- 2 cups light brown sugar, firmly packed 
- 3 cups sweetened flaked coconut 
- 1 1/2 cups powdered sugar 
- 2 tablespoons fresh lime juice 
- 2 teaspoons lime zest 
Directions:
1. Preheat oven to 350 degrees F.
2. Combine flour, sugar, and salt in a bowl. Cut in butter until mixture resembles coarse meal. Press crust into a parchment paper lined 10 by 15-inch baking pan. Bake for 15 minutes or until golden brown.
3. Mix eggs, nuts, brown sugar, and coconut until well blended; spread over baked crust.
4. Bake an additional 30 minutes or until set. While still warm, mix together the powdered sugar, lime juice, and zest with a fork. Working quickly, spread the lime paste all over the top with a spatula. Let cool to room temperature and cut into bars.
